Starting from Puerto Montt / Puerto Varas, travel to Chiloé Island to see penguins at Puñihuil Islets, the UNESCO wooden churches of Chiloé and to hike at the Chiloé National Park and Tepuheico Park for striking views of the Pacific Ocean. Return to a base in Puerto Varas to trek at the Alerce Andino National Park, visit the Petrohué Waterfalls, cross the Todos los Santos Lake and visit Peulla; trek the Osorno Volcano in the Vicente Perez Rosales National Park; a complete tour around Llanquihue Lake visiting quaint towns with German influence; and end your adventure with a local experience at the picturesque markets in Puerto Montt.

Join a semi-private excursion by motor coach along the scenic Lake Llanquihue and into the Vicente Pérez Rosales National Park to Lake Todos los Santos (All Saints Lake). Board a catamaran to navigate to Peulla, with time there for an optional lunch or adventure excursion, before returning via catamaran and coach.

Depart from the pier or your hotel in Puerto Varas/Puerto Montt and travel to the skirts of Osorno Volcano, to the Vicente Perez Rosales National Park and the Laguna Verde area. Visit the three main points of the Park: Osorno Volcano, Petrohué Waterfalls and Todos Los Santos Lake.

 

Hike Paso Desolacion (Desolation Pass) between the Osorno and Cerro La Picada volcanoes. Soak in the amazing vistas of Calbuco, Puntiagudo, Tronador, Yates volcanoes, the Patagonian Andes, Llanquihue and Todos Los Santos Lake. Enjoy panoramic views of the unrivaled beauty.

A family oriented excursion visits the Burbuja area where a ski resort is located, there see the glacial run-off from the volcano’s slopes and glaciers, the Petrohué Waterfalls, and Todos Los Santos Lago; takes short hikes on the nature trails of Los Enamorados and Carilemu.
